Cellular: Fix BG96 offloaded DNS query for new API
Fixed following issues in BG96 offloaded DNS: - Fixed mbed-os 6 API change for asynchronous DNS callback. Return value is no longer an error value but in success case the amount of DNS records - Asynchronous request returns request ID instead of NSAPI_ERROR_OK. BG96 supports only one asynchronouse DNS query at the time, so ID 1 is used. - BG96 does not support multi-ip DNS responses, so disabled multi-ip testspull/12830/head
